Kokanee Cove Accepting Group Reservations at Ponderosa State Park
The Idaho Department of Parks and Recreation is thrilled to announce group reservations for the new cabins and renovated event facility at Ponderosa State Park. This is a major milestone to improve recreational experience for guests who visit the state park.
"The Kokanee Cove project has been a long time coming to replace all dilapidated buildings. This area's main use is for group functions, which has typically not been available at the park. I am excited to increase available facilities to our guests in a setting which will create lifelong memories," said park manager Matt Linde.
The updated facility is a perfect backdrop for weddings and group events. Groups can rent all 6 cabins which can sleep in total 24 people and the event center capable of hosting 60 people for up to 4 nights in a row. This project is special as it will enhance public access to the popular Payette Lake.
"These state-of-the-art cabins and event facility at Ponderosa State Park will be enjoyed by visitors for years to come" said Director Susan Buxton.
Interested in booking? Call Ponderosa State Park at 208-634-2164 to book your reservation starting on June 17, 2026. Group reservations can be made twelve months before your event. Individual cabin rental reservations are available nine months before your stay. We look forward to hosting you at Kokanee Cove, where groups retreat and nature leads. Kokanee Cove marks a new chapter for Ponderosa State Park to bring visitors together in the heart of one of Idaho's most iconic state parks.
